Annual Meeting and Pig Picking


Tha Annual Meeting was attended by 100 members and guests who experienced  a very emotional meeting with three special presentations.

President Jim Keene was presented a custom rod and reel with his NCBBA number wrapped into the hand grip thanking him for 10 years of service to NCBBA as President and many additional years serving on the Board of Directors. Jim now becomes the most recent past president and will be seated on the Board as a new director and will continue as our NCBBA representative to CHAPA.

Past President John Newbold was also presented with a custom rod and reel with his NCBBA number wrapped in the hand grip recognizing him for 30 plus years of service to NCBBA as Mr. Everything including President . John will no longer be a member of the Board but will continue as the Fishing News Editor for our newsletter.

The Brian Edwards Memorial Trophy for the Russ Privett Memerial Tournament was presented to Mr. John Newbold in appreciation of the time and talent he has given to NCBBA over the past 30 years. Mr. and Mrs. Edwards presented this award to John as there were no Junior Members who caught a fish  in the tournament.

This is how its done! The lady on the left is Michele Horrigan and on the right is Deb Gardiner both from Chesterfield, VA. Photo was taken on Saturday September 25, 2010 at Ramp 44. These ladies took our request to remove trash from the beach to a new level. The nylon bags they removed from the beach are the remains of the large sandbags that were used to secure the Cape Hatteras Lighthouse prior to its movement to the present location. NCBBA and UMS Education Scholarships

NCBBA proudly supports post High School education for Outer Banks' students. The 2010-2011 school years represents NCBBA's 12th consecutive year awarding $2,000 renewable scholarships to Dare County students. More than $42,000 has been awarded since the inception of the program.

This year NCBBA introduces a Member-Member's children post High School Scholarship renewable for 4 years. Your organization recognizes the many members are facing retraining or returning to college as part of the economic downturn in our country. This scholarship is funded by NCBBA to assist our members and their children in this process. Contact Director Mike Metzgar at Mike.Metzgar@NCBBA.org. for an application.

Applications for Dare County NCBBA scholarships are available from HS Guidance Counselors or by contacting Director Mike Metzgar at Mike.Metzgar@NCBBA.org. Please enter 'scholarship' in the email subject box when requesting the application.

 

UMS (United Mobile Sportfishermen) also supports higher education and offers a post secondary education scholarship to all Members/Members Children of UMS Organizations. NCBBA is a member of UMS.
